Smart Eating Strategies (When Working from Home)
Working from home? Smart eating strategies to stay healthy and productive at home
Working from home can easily throw a spanner in the works when it comes to healthy eating. When your office and home are one entity, and the kitchen is within arm’s reach, it can feel like an uphill battle when it comes to making smart eating choices. With your food supply in such close proximity, you may find yourself frequenting the kitchen in times of stress, boredom, indecisiveness, or most commonly – work procrastination mode.
What’s more, as the Corona virus crisis unfolds, we may struggle to source our favourite foods and go-to ingredients for healthy meals – instead having to get creative with store cupboard essentials and frozen food.
This webinar will provide smarter eating strategies to ensure working from home during COVID-19 doesn’t derail your healthy diet.
